Transaction d56a266624fc29ed709f561bc99243489bc99f5199ec1d4272e530c87fd52790
1 Input
2 Outputs
- d56a266624fc29ed709f561bc99243489bc99f5199ec1d4272e530c87fd52790:0
- d56a266624fc29ed709f561bc99243489bc99f5199ec1d4272e530c87fd52790:1
value 1430030370
address 1F6TLsu9BPipA61YpsnCFJVPHVX11EUNFW
value 4397000
address 3Hj6wJH5EdAQ3JSvfERvHk4cA55UwSQ4fw